School Leadership is committed to supporting PK-12 schools, students and staff. We hold schools accountable by trusting them, creating their trust in us and remaining open to reciprocal honesty.
We support the district's efforts to close the achievement gaps and promote academic proficiency in all students. This division also works to support Student Engagement, Career and Technical Education (CTE), Visual and Performing Arts (VAPA), Adult Education, Parent Engagement, and Early Childhood Education (ECE).

Elementary
The Elementary Education Department is an educational unit within the School Leadership Division, and supports the mission and vision for students in grades PK-8. The work of Elementary Education is to provide direction, support, monitoring, and evaluation of schools and their programs in order to ensure an excellent academic program for all students within a supportive and welcoming learning environment. Elementary Education works closely with other departments like Secondary Education, Special Education, English Learner Services Department, Professional Development, and VAPA to support the success of all students. Elementary Education consults frequently with Human Resources and various departments within Administrative Services.
